    Re: Tech Spec tank pads

    I run these on my bike. Two thumbs up.

    I noticed two big differences when I put them on. It's a lot easier to stay in place under braking and they keep the outside knee in place on turns.

    I can still move around on the bike, it just takes less pressure to stay put.
